WebJun 13, 2024 · Paper bonds can be redeemed at some bank branches. Call beforehand to verify your bank provides this service and to make an appointment, if needed. You can also redeem paper bonds by... WebMar 4, 2024 · If you want to cash in an electronic bond, you can do it easily online via TreasuryDirect.gov. Once you’ve redeemed it online, it can take as many as two business days for the funds to transfer to your checking or savings account. Keep in mind that if you cash in a paper Series EE bond, you must redeem it in full; individual bonds cannot be split. WebMay 1, 2024 · 4.
